Issue description
Chrome Version : 49.0.2623.110 (Official Build) m (64 bit)
What steps will reproduce the problem?
condition: set Basic > On startup > Reopen the pages that were open last.
(1) open some tabs.
(2) close chrome browser.
(3) reopen chrome browser.
(4) when reopend tab reloads from cache,
chrome.tabs.update({url: emailUrl}); does not work.
(page icon looks reloading)
emailUrl is javascript variable.
var emailUrl = "mailto:hogehoge@example.com"
when close tab reloads from cache, and reopen new tab, works good.
but reopened tab from cache, doesn't works good.
